1. Plan Ahead and Research the Area

Before you go on your next vacation, it’s important to research the area and plan ahead. Not only will this help to ensure a safe and pleasant experience, but it can also save you a lot of hassle and money. By following these simple tips, you can make sure that your vacation goes smoothly and that you don’t get into any trouble.

When researching the laws and regulations of the place you are visiting, be sure to familiarize yourself with everything from visa requirements to traffic laws. Additionally, be aware of local customs and culture – things may be different from what you are used to. If you are traveling with family or friends, make sure to discuss any safety concerns or unusual behaviors in advance.

In addition to research, it’s also important to have copies of important documents on hand in case something happens while you are away. Make sure that these documents are up-to-date so that no problems arise while you’re away. Finally, consider packing some basic emergency supplies such as a first aid kit and water filter in case of an emergency situation. And if possible, book lodging in advance so that there is no need for last minute scrambling. Remember – always take precautions before traveling anywhere!

3. Know Where to Get Help If Needed

Before you travel, it’s important to be aware of government travel advisories. These advisories are issued by the United States State Department, the United Kingdom Foreign and Commonwealth Office, or Canada’s Department of Foreign Affairs, Trade and Development. They provide information on the current state of security in a particular country and recommend specific precautions that should be taken by travelers.

It’s also important to stay up to date with global events. By doing so, you’ll be able to better understand the risks involved with your destination and make informed decisions about your trip. For example, if there is an ongoing conflict in a particular country, you’ll want to avoid that area. Likewise, if there have been recent terrorist attacks in a city you’re visiting, take precautions such as avoiding large crowds and keeping your personal belongings secure.
